This delightful audio is ideal for preschool children. In it, 47 beavers come to life through the imaginative rendition of two narrators. Lovers of Veggietales will enjoy this story of beavers who are lost at sea.

Just 15 minutes long, the story is first read by Greg Whalen, who easily captures attention with a dramatic delivery. Then the author reads the same story in a singsong and whimsical tone, creating a different mood. Instrumental music adds a nice touch. Not only will the story entice a children to listen, it will teach them the value of working with others to find solutions to problems.
